Commercial Site Clearing in Houston, TX
Commercial site clearing services involve the removal of trees, shrubs, debris, and existing structures to prepare a property for new construction, development, or landscaping projects. These services are suitable for a variety of projects, including building sites, parking lots, retail spaces, industrial facilities, and office complexes.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of clearing work, including whether it covers tree removal, stump grinding, debris hauling, and grading, as well as any potential impact on existing features or neighboring properties.
Before requesting site clearing, property owners should consider the size and complexity of the project, the types of vegetation or structures that need removal, and any permits or regulations that may apply in Houston, TX, and surrounding areas. It’s also helpful to clarify specific goals for the site, such as leveling or preparing for construction, to ensure the clearing process aligns with future development plans. Proper planning and understanding of the process can help facilitate a smooth and efficient project.

Common Commercial Site Clearing Jobs
Commercial Site Clearing - clearing large areas of land for development or construction projects.
Vegetation Removal - removing trees, shrubs, and underbrush to prepare sites for building.
Stump Grinding - grinding down tree stumps to create a smooth, level surface.
Debris Removal - clearing away leftover branches, logs, and other materials from sites.
Grading and Leveling - shaping the land to ensure proper drainage and a stable foundation.
Lot Preparation - clearing and preparing land for new construction or landscaping projects.
Commercial Site Clearing Questions
What types of sites are suitable for clearing services? Commercial site clearing services are typically used for properties preparing for new construction, renovations, or land development projects.
What equipment is used during site clearing? Heavy machinery such as bulldozers, excavators, and loaders are commonly employed to remove trees, brush, and debris efficiently.
Are there any restrictions on clearing certain types of land? Yes, some areas may have regulations or restrictions regarding tree removal, wetlands, or protected habitats that impact clearing work.
What should property owners consider before clearing a site? It’s important to assess the land’s topography, existing structures, and any local regulations to ensure proper planning and compliance.
